@@ Introduction Recently, the magnetic domain wall (DW) dynamics in ferromagnetic nanowires by the spin-transfer torque (STT) or the propagating spin wave are actively studied due to the possibility of next generation memory applications and interesting underlying physics. For better understanding of the spin dynamics related to the DW motion, we have investigated the interaction between spin polarized current and the DW by employing micromagnetic simulations.
